WESTON
Market Trends Report
March 2012
The Weston, Connecticut real estate market is still trending down. The latest 3 month comparison shows that both the number of sales and sale prices are still declining.
The amount of inventory that the market can absorb is still low. We use the 12 month absorption rate (see chart above) to determine inventory absorption, which means that it would take about 14-15 months to sell every home currently on the market in Weston. This is slightly higher than most other Fairfield County towns.
Although it is still a Buyers Market in Weston, this has been an active Spring market in Fairfield County, so we hope next month's chart shows more green areas and less orange.
